To ask Her Majesty's Government in how many overseas locations Department for International Trade officials are co-located with the staff of Scottish Development International; and how this has changed over the last five years.

Photo of Baroness Fairhead Baroness Fairhead The Minister of State, Department for International Trade

The Department for International Trade (DIT) (and previously UKTI staff) are co-located with Scottish Development International (SDI) staff in a number of locations; specific details below. DIT are always prepared, where logistically possible to work with SDI colleagues on co-location overseas.

Brazil Rio de Janeiro

Canada Calgary and Toronto

USA November 2017

Australia & New Zealand Melbourne since 2016 (previously Sydney)

China Beijing

Hong Kong

India Mymbai, New Delhi and Hydrabad

Denmark Copenhagen

Ghana Accra

Saudi Arabia Al Khobar – established February 2014

UAE Dubai

Taiwan Taipei
